What is an ADHD assessment?

If you or your child are struggling with ADHD symptoms, you may require professional assessment and diagnosis to determine how it affects your performance and well-being. Psychologists have been trained to recognize ADHD in children and adults. They can also offer support and treatment options, which include medication.

Most of the time, an adult who is concerned they might be suffering from ADHD is referred to a private adhd assessment ireland cost specialist by their physician or contact the service directly to schedule a consultation with a psychiatrist skilled in ADHD assessments. The procedure for an ADHD assessment varies from the provider to the provider. It typically begins with a questionnaire to determine if you exhibit certain ADHD symptoms. As part of the screening, you might also receive the form to distribute to family members as well as friends or colleagues. These forms are important to ensure that your appointment goes smoothly and that the clinician will review the information in advance of your appointment.

If the results of the screening show an increased likelihood that you are suffering from ADHD symptoms you will be invited to attend a face-to-face ADHD assessment with the psychiatrist. The session usually lasts about an hour and involves an examination of your current issues and the background of ADHD symptoms, and their impact on your performance. The psychiatrist will also ask you to rate how much does private adhd assessment cost much ADHD symptoms cause problems in your day-to-day life, and in particular circumstances such as at work or school.

Once your assessment is completed the psychiatrist will provide a thorough report and discuss with you what the findings of the assessment could help you decide on the future course of treatment. You will be asked if you would like to test the medication, and which option is best for your situation.

If you are diagnosed, it is advisable to check with your GP whether they will accept the shared care agreement so that you can receive the medication you require through the NHS. What is the procedure for an ADHD assessment?

A private assessment for adhd northern ireland ADHD assessment is a physical examination carried out by a medical professional. They are typically psychiatrists with experience in diagnosing ADHD as well as related conditions like depression, anxiety and dyslexia.

The assessment is carried out by a qualified physician, who will speak with the patients and go over the documents provided prior to the appointment. Additional tests or screenings could be suggested based on the patient's symptoms and the circumstances.

Adults with ADHD might be required to complete the Diagnostic Interview for ADHD in Adults (DIVA) which is a common questionaire that is utilized by many psychiatrists around the world. It asks questions about the frequency of symptoms and the impact on the person's lifestyle and work, as well as relationships. Adults with ADHD must be honest when answering questions so that they can receive a valid diagnose.

Children with ADHD might require a more thorough assessment, which could include interviews with teachers, coaches and daycare providers. The specialist could also request a sample of the child's report cards and schoolwork.

In some cases, a specialist will want to see the patient at the clinic or at their home to examine their behavior and symptoms. They will ask that the patient bring along their GP referral letter, as well as any documents or questionnaires that were completed prior to the appointment.
